Comp tac CTAC

I purchased and recieved this holster, however I have yet to use it as my CPL has yet to arrive. It is for my XDSC9. I am not sure if I made the right decision, seeing how popular the crossbreeds are around here, but I am going to try it and see how I like it.

I am tall with a thin frame (6'2" 175 lbs) and it seems to fit me best at the 5 oclock position. One thing I noticed while taking it out of the holster is that it seems to mark the very end of my slide with a light smudge/scratch mark. It is very small and only near the opening of the barrel on the left side, but I dont want to turn into a big deal. Anyone have any comments on this issue?

I've noticed smudging from my CTAC. I thought it was wearing the finish on my slide, but it seems to be some residue from the holster. I was taking a Defensive Shooting class and had to practice my draw a lot, so my Sig P220 Carry came out of the holster many times. When I first saw the blemish, I got ticked, but found I could wipe it off with some effort. After awhile, it stopped appearing, so I figured the holster just needed some break in time. No problems now and I love the holster. It's very comfortable and can be adjusted for cant and height to fit my preferences.

The C.T.A.C. is a good holster IMO. It holds your firearm securely, allows you to cant it to your liking, keeps the handle where you can easily obtain a grip on it and finally, it keeps your pants off your weapon.

If you have a problem with your grip printing, you can slide the gun around to the 3 o'clock position and cant it all the way forward...

If it's leaving scracthes, use some super dooper fine sand paper to smooth her out just a little. OR make sure you don't have dirt on your holster or your gun. That'll also do it.
